Among their many benefits to individuals and communities, sports are known for fostering unity and promoting growth and teamwork.Throughout history, games have been used by communities to remedy cycles of mistrust and conflict, strengthening ties and bringing people together. Under the right circumstances, sports can help build safer, stronger and healthier relationships between groups of people.
Some agencies sponsor games with the aim of helping children in unstable areas. According to statistics recently released by PeacePlayers International, more than one billion children live in unsafe communities, and in many cases, sport has been proven to be a buffer against violence. Often in such communities, kids take a hostile view towards outsiders. However, given the chance to compete against them on the playing field, children from different places get the chance to talk with, and ultimately learn about each other. In doing so, they can find common ground and set aside their differences.
There is perhaps no better example of the unifying spirit of sport than the Olympics. Ever since their beginnings in ancient times, the Games have brought competitors from all over the world together to represent their communities in various competitions. The Olympics have proven very effective at bridging the gap between different cultures and communities: In addition to the athletes, the Games draw in spectators from across the globe, eager to cheer on their nations. Through both playing and spectating, people set aside their differences at the Olympics to celebrate their shared love of sport and competition.
Having seen the success of sporting activities in uniting communities, companies are incorporating them into their team building initiatives. Sport-related activities are a very popular way for companies to motivate employees to work together. By competing alongside one another, they learn to trust other members of their team, and to defer to them in the areas where they are best talented. Ultimately, this enhanced teamwork helps everybody achieve more together than they can alone.
